I love the idea of one-size diapers as all you need. However, my 3 month old is just now really starting to fit in the one-size diapers I have (they fit before but looked uncomfortably big and bulky). So far I get a great fit with bumGenius, Blueberry, and my lone Happy Heiny one-size pocket diapers.

I just had my baby girl 9 weeks ago and she’s just getting big enough to start with the cloth diapers I bought before she was born. I bought a big, random assortment, including several pocket diapers. I think that there are pluses and minuses to pocket vs. AIO vs. prefolds. The pocket and AIO are both super absorbent and easy to use. The main difference I see is that the AIOs have one less step (you don’t have to stuff them) but since they tend to be pretty thick and the layers of material don’t separate, they take longer to wash and dry.

I have a whole stash of BG 3.0 and love them. I chose them over HH because of the flap over the insert slit in the back, and they were $1 cheaper per diaper. I also didn’t like the huge Velcro rectangle on the one side of the HH one-size, but that’s just looks. I love my BGs, but I’d take a couple free HH to try!
